AI Summary

  • Establishes a mandatory 12-month minimum incarceration sentence for theft in the first degree convictions where the value of stolen property or services exceeds $250,000

  • Applies the mandatory minimum whether imposed as part of an indeterminate 10-year prison term or as a condition of a 4-year probation/supervision sentence

  • Prohibits suspension or waiver of the mandatory 12-month imprisonment period under any circumstances

  • Theft in the first degree currently applies to theft exceeding $20,000, theft of firearms or explosives, theft from elderly persons, theft of motor vehicles, and theft during declared emergencies

  • Does not affect rights, duties, penalties, or proceedings that began before the Act's effective date
